Where to Find Political Donations

In today’s political landscape, finding reliable sources of political donations is crucial for candidates and political parties. Donations not only provide the necessary funds to run campaigns but also serve as a measure of public support. However, with numerous options available, it can be challenging to determine the best avenues for securing these contributions. This article will explore various sources and strategies for finding political donations.

1. Individual Donors

One of the most common sources of political donations is individual donors. These individuals may be motivated by various factors, such as personal beliefs, political ideology, or a desire to support a particular candidate. To find individual donors, political campaigns can utilize several methods:

– Networking events: Attending community events, political gatherings, and social functions can help campaigns connect with potential donors.
– Direct mail: Sending personalized letters or postcards to potential donors can encourage them to contribute.
– Online fundraising: Creating a donation page on a crowdfunding platform or a campaign website can make it easy for individuals to contribute online.

2. Corporate Donations

Corporate donations can be a significant source of funds for political campaigns. However, it is essential to note that many states and countries have strict regulations regarding corporate political contributions. To find corporate donors, consider the following strategies:

– Research potential donors: Identify companies that align with your campaign’s values and have a history of supporting political causes.
– Build relationships: Establishing a rapport with corporate representatives can increase the likelihood of receiving a donation.
– Compliance with regulations: Ensure that your campaign complies with all relevant laws and regulations regarding corporate donations.

3. Political Action Committees (PACs)

Political Action Committees (PACs) are organizations that pool funds from individuals, corporations, and labor unions to support political candidates. To find PACs that may be interested in donating to your campaign, consider the following approaches:

– Research PACs: Identify PACs that align with your campaign’s values and have a history of supporting candidates similar to yours.
– Build relationships: Reach out to PAC representatives to discuss potential support and establish a rapport.
– Monitor PAC activity: Keep an eye on PACs’ donation history and public statements to gauge their interest in supporting your campaign.

5. Crowdfunding

Crowdfunding platforms have become increasingly popular for political campaigns, allowing candidates to raise funds from a large number of individual donors. To leverage crowdfunding for your campaign, consider the following tips:

– Create an engaging campaign: Develop a compelling story and visual content to attract potential donors.
– Utilize social media: Share your campaign on social media platforms to reach a wider audience.
– Offer incentives: Provide incentives for donors, such as campaign merchandise or exclusive updates.
